Your new role

As Senior Director, Finance & Operations (F&O), you will serve as the CFO of Novo Nordisk Canada Inc. (NNCI) and a key member of the Canadian Executive Team. You will lead the strategic agenda for F&O in a dynamic environment shaped by Loss of Exclusivity (LOE), Most Favoured Nation (MFN) pricing considerations and evolving regulatory demands, while partnering closely with the NNCI President, the EUCAN VP of Finance and the SVP, EUCAN to drive NNCI's sustainable growth.

Your Key Responsibilities Will Include
  • Providing full oversight of the NNCI P&L, presenting financial results and projections to the Executive Team, EUCAN Office and Headquarters, and leading discussions that define the affiliate's overall financial strategy
  • Providing financial consultation on existing brands, new product launches, LOE & MFN strategies, strategic alliances and pricing – including oversight of PMPRB (Patented Medicine Prices Review Board) compliance and PLA (Product Listing Agreement) agreement execution
  • Assessing the affiliate's risk profile, maintaining the system of internal financial controls, and ensuring compliance with Canadian tax law, transfer pricing, corporate and indirect tax obligations
  • Providing strategic direction for the Finance, Supply Chain and IT functions – including oversight of the 3PL Distribution Agreement and ensuring technology platforms align with corporate standards
  • Acting as an Officer of NNCI liaising with statutory auditors, the Canada Revenue Agency, logistics providers, distributors, wholesalers, lawyers and consultants
  • Representing NNCI externally, including on the Pharma CFO Forum, and contributing to global teams and regional tax strategy development
  • Leading, developing and retaining a diverse team of finance professionals, fostering a collaborative environment of mutual accountability and championing a quality mindset across all F&O processes

Your Skills & Qualifications

We are looking for an enterprise thinker with a growth mindset – a proven leader who thrives in a complex, matrixed environment and can turn financial insight into commercial impact. To succeed in this role, you will bring:

  • A university degree with specialisation in Finance or Accounting, combined with a CPA/CA designation (or equivalent)
  • 10+ years of experience in financial and people leadership roles, with a proven track record of leading large, complex teams within the pharmaceutical industry, FMCG and/or Technology
  • Superior strategic and tactical planning experience within a pharmaceutical environment, along with strong commercial acumen and enterprise-wide change management experience
  • Strong analytical, strategic planning, influencing and communication skills, with the ability to engage credibly with executives, external stakeholders and global partners
  • Demonstrated capability to build, motivate and develop diverse teams, coupled with excellent interpersonal, collaboration and relationship-building skills
  • A high degree of integrity and transparency, aligned with the Novo Nordisk Way
